I'd like to compare insurance info. I understand your driving record as well as location will be a factor. Not to mention what coverage you opted for. Here is mine, and I feel it could be lower.
I'll start:
29yrs old here.
Located in the South Central US.
My city has a population of 1190 (small, yes) w/ very low crime rate.
My driving record is:
-driving with improper equipment (my window tint was limo tinted)
-Suspended license (I traveled outside the US on business after I got the window ticket and forgot to pay it. Resulted in suspended license)
-Expired tags (when I was away on business I forgot to renew my tags, was pulled over for expired tags)
All 3 of the above happened within the past 12 months. All 3 have been remedied and payed for. And all 3 are being worked on to get expunged. I have written a letter to the judge for attempted expungement. Waiting on reply.
My vehicle is a 2009 Chevy Corvette 3LT with every option except magnetic ride and z51
My quote is through geico and costs a total of $210 per month. $1232 every 6 months. Below is what I have:
Bodily Injury Liability: $50k/$100k
Property Damage Liability: $50k
Lost Earnings: $400 per week
Uninsured Motorist Bodily Injury: $50k/$100k
Uninsured Motorist Property Damage $25k/$200 deductible
Underinsured Motorist: $25k/50k
Comprehensive(COMP): $500 deductible
Collision(COLL): $1000 deductible
Emergency Road Service: (YES)
Rental Reimbursement: $30 per day
Comp and Collision are eating my lunch but I'd hate to increase either of them.
